Psystyle is a hardstyle subgenre that blends the rolling, hypnotic basslines and acidic leads of psytrance with the punchy 150 BPM kicks, anthem-writing, and arrangement habits of modern hardstyle.
Typically, a psystyle track opens with a DJ-friendly mid-intro driven by a psy-style rolling bass and syncopated percussive patterns, then pivots into hardstyle build-ups and drops powered by distorted kick-and-tail sound design. The result is high-energy, festival-ready music that feels both trancey and relentless, combining psychedelic timbres with big-room hard dance impact.
Psystyle emerged in the 2010s within the Dutch-led hardstyle circuit as producers looked for fresh sound palettes beyond established euphoric and rawstyle formulas. At the same time, psytrance—especially full-on and festival-focused sounds—was experiencing a mainstream resurgence. The combination of psytrance’s rolling bass engines and psychedelic leads with hardstyle’s 150 BPM drive and powerful kick design catalyzed a distinct hybrid.
Mid-2010s festival sets began to feature psy-tinged mid-intros that segued into hardstyle drops. Producers experimented with psytrance bass patterns (often at 1/16th subdivisions), FM/acid leads, and gated sequences, then paired them with hardstyle’s signature punchy kick-and-tail. This approach quickly proved effective on big stages, where the trancey tension of the mid-intro released into explosive, crowd-pleasing hardstyle climaxes.
By the late 2010s, the psystyle toolkit had solidified: 150 BPM tempos, psychedelic motifs (squelchy 303-like lines, metallic FM arps), and hardstyle arrangement structures (build/break/climax) became standard. The sound offered a darker, more hypnotic alternative to euphoric hardstyle while remaining more anthemic and structured than most psytrance.
In the 2020s, psystyle remained a go-to flavor for large events, playlisted mixes, and peak-time moments. While not supplanting other hardstyle strands, it became a durable color in the broader hard dance palette, sustaining cross-pollination between hardstyle and psytrance scenes.
